Reporting to Vicki Fung, PhD and John Hsu, MD, MBA, MSCE, the Data Analyst will play a key role in conducting health policy research. These studies will produce generalizable, publishable findings. The Data Analyst will work collaboratively with a team of investigators, including health services researchers, clinicians, economists, and biostatisticians, as needed. The Data Analyst will be responsible for translating research questions into analytic plans; analyzing data, including medical and pharmacy claims data and clinical data; conducting valid statistical tests and statistical models; and assisting with data visualization and communicating findings in presentations and manuscripts.
We are looking for someone with advanced training in biostatistics, epidemiology, economics, statistics, or a related field, and experience analyzing health care data. Experience using administrative claims data is a plus. Specific tasks will include: extracting, managing, and analyzing medical and pharmacy claims data; working with investigators and staff to obtain and link data sources to answer study questions; creating longitudinal patient cohorts that can be analyzed over time; evaluating the impact of health policies on health care costs, utilization and quality; and conducting valid statistical tests and advanced modeling. As part of all of these activities, the Data Analyst will apply excellent data cleaning/evaluation, data management, and statistical programming skills.
Qualifications
MPH, Master’s Degree, or PhD in Biostatistics, Epidemiology, Economics, Statistics, Health Services Research, or closely related field
Familiarity with health care data, such as administrative claims or electronic medical record data
Research experience a plus
General Skills:
Organizational skills
Research and problem-solving skills, e.g., ability to formulate and test hypotheses
Ability to work both independently and as part of a team
Ability to mentor earlier stage analysts
Communication skills
Technical Skills: Advanced training in biostatistics or related field, with advanced knowledge of statistical testing and multivariate modeling required. Strong programming skills in SAS or STATA or R required, and willing to learn other programming languages as necessary. Relational database experience (MS Access, Oracle, and/or SQL server). Excellent skills in communicating quantitative findings in visual format (tables or graphs).
